Market Overview
Rapid diagnostic tests are medical devices designed to provide preliminary or definitive test results quickly, typically within 5 to 30 minutes, without requiring specialized laboratory equipment or trained technicians. The global market for these products was valued at approximately $28.02 billion in 2025 and is projected to grow at a compound annual growth rate of 8.88%, reflecting broad adoption across clinical, home, and workplace settings. Rapid tests are used across a wide range of applications, including infectious disease screening, chronic disease management, pregnancy testing, drug screening, and food safety testing, making them a critical component of modern point-of-care diagnostics.

Growth Drivers
The COVID-19 pandemic served as a major catalyst, creating unprecedented manufacturing scale, regulatory pathways, and public familiarity with rapid antigen testing. Beyond the pandemic, the rising global burden of infectious diseases, increasing prevalence of diabetes and other chronic conditions, and aging demographics are driving sustained demand. Technological advancements, such as improved lateral flow assay sensitivity, isothermal amplification techniques, and lab-on-a-chip platforms, are expanding the clinical utility of rapid tests. Favorable reimbursement policies, regulatory support for over-the-counter diagnostics, and the proliferation of direct-to-consumer health channels further accelerate adoption.

Segmentation and Regional Analysis
The rapid tests market is segmented by product type, application, end user, and distribution channel. Product categories include lateral flow assays (the largest segment, widely used for infectious disease and pregnancy testing), rapid immunoassays, molecular rapid tests, and rapid chromatographic immunoassays. By application, infectious disease testing commands the largest share, followed by cardiology, pregnancy, and diabetes testing. Geographically, North America holds the largest market share, supported by advanced healthcare infrastructure and high per-capita health spending. Asia-Pacific is the fastest-growing region, driven by large populations, rising healthcare investment, and increasing demand in emerging economies, while Europe maintains a significant and mature market presence.

Trends and Outlook
What are the recent trends and outlook?
Looking ahead, the rapid tests market is expected to sustain its growth trajectory through 2030, supported by continued investment in decentralized diagnostics and pandemic preparedness. Key trends include the integration of digital health technologies such as smartphone-linked result readers and cloud-connected reporting systems, the development of multiplex rapid tests capable of detecting multiple pathogens simultaneously, and increasing consumer adoption of at-home testing kits for routine health monitoring. Emerging technologies, including CRISPR-Cas-based diagnostics and electrochemical biosensors, promise to further improve test accuracy and expand the range of detectable conditions. Regulatory bodies are also streamlining approvals for novel rapid diagnostic platforms, which should accelerate time-to-market for innovative products.
